Personalis Clinches Medicare Coverage Wins, Posts 30% Revenue Growth

  • Personalis secured Medicare coverage for NeXT Personal in immunotherapy monitoring and neoadjuvant therapy monitoring for breast cancer.
  • Q2 revenue grew 30% YoY to $22.4M, with clinical test revenue up 442% YoY to $2.6M.
  • NeXT Personal detected 100% of colorectal cancer relapses in the VICTORI study.
  • Personalis ended Q2 with $212.7M in cash and short-term investments.

Personalis' Q2 results underscore the growing demand for advanced genomics in precision oncology, particularly as payers like Medicare expand coverage for molecular testing. The company's strategic focus on minimal residual disease (MRD) detection aligns with broader industry shifts toward earlier cancer intervention. With $212.7M in cash and a pending merger with Tempus, Personalis is positioning itself for scale but faces execution risks in integrating the deal.
